摘要
Spruce chips applied for a pulp production are in the first place stored, usually 1 or 2 months. In this time their molecular structure can be changed due to atmospheric and biodeterioration processes, and some of the occurring changes may have a positive effect on the pulp quality. To estimate some principles of the biotic effects in a natural pile, in the presented work, spruce chips have been subjected to model degradation processes caused by selected white-rot fungi: Phanerochaete chrysosporium, Heterobasidion annosum, Onnia circinata or Climaeocystis borealis, and the brown-rot fungus Fomitopsis pinicola, under laboratory conditions during 3 or 6 weeks. The aim of our experiment was to find advisable storage conditions of chips to achieve satisfactory acid sulphite pulp quality. 3-week degradation of chips by Phanerochaete chrysosporium did not influence the yield and strength of pulps markedly, and brought a benefit of reduced Kappa number, reduced contents of lipophilic compounds and diminished the amount of rejects.
